Coconut aminos is a flavorful liquid made from the sap of coconut blossoms, mixed with natural ingredients such as garlic and sea salt. Unlike soy sauce, it is not only gluten-free but also soy-free, making it an excellent choice for those with dietary restrictions or sensitivities. The aging process ensures that this condiment achieves a complex, umami-rich profile with subtle hints of sweetness and saltiness that enhance the taste of your dishes. Coconut treacle, crafted from the nectar of the coconut flower, is an extraordinary, organic, and natural alternative to conventional sweeteners. Just as maple syrup is produced by tapping the sap of maple trees, coconut treacle is made by collecting the sweet nectar from coconut blossoms. This nectar is then carefully evaporated according to certified organic standards, ensuring its purity and consistency.
Coconut vinegar is a unique alternative to other types of vinegar. It has a milder taste, appears to be nutritious and may offer several health benefits. These range from weight loss and a lower risk of diabetes to a healthier digestion, immune system and heart.
